% Lua filter types and objects % Albert Krewinkel % Oct 6, 2018 ## Pandoc `blocks` : document content ([list] of [blocks]) `meta` : document meta information ([Meta] object) ## Meta Meta information on a document; string-indexed collection of [meta values](#metavalue). This is represented as a string-indexed table containing [meta values](#MetaValue). ## MetaValue Document meta information items. ### MetaBlocks A list of blocks usable as meta value ([list] of [blocks]) Fields: `tag`, `t` : the literal `MetaBlocks` (string) ### MetaBool Plain Lua boolean value (boolean) ### MetaInlines List of inlines used in metadata ([list] of [inline]s) Fields: `tag`, `t` : the literal `MetaInlines` (string) ### MetaList A list of other [meta value]s. ([list]) Fields: `tag`, `t` : the literal `MetaList` (string) ### MetaMap A string-indexed map of meta-values. (table) Fields: `tag`, `t` : the literal `MetaMap` (string) *Note*: The fields will be shadowed if the map contains a field with the same name as those listed. ### MetaString Plain Lua string value (string) ## Block ### BlockQuote A block quote element content: : block content ([list] of [blocks]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`BlockQuote` (string) ### BulletList A bullet list `content` : list of items ([list] of [blocks]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`BulletList` (string) ### CodeBlock Block of code. `text` : code string (string) `attr` : element attributes (Attr) `identifier` : alias for `attr.identifier` (string) `classes` : alias for `attr.classes` ([list] of strings) `attributes` : alias for `attr.attributes` ([Attributes]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`CodeBlock` (string) ### DefinitionList Definition list, containing terms and their explanation. `content` : list of items `tag`, `t` : the literal `DefinitionList` (string) ### Div Generic block container with attributes `content` : block content ([list] of [blocks]) `attr` : element attributes (Attr) `identifier` : alias for `attr.identifier` (string) `classes` : alias for `attr.classes` ([list] of strings) `attributes` : alias for `attr.attributes` ([Attributes]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Div` (string) ### Header Creates a header element. `level` : header level (integer) `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`attr` : element attributes (Attr) `identifier` : alias for `attr.identifier` (string) `classes` : alias for `attr.classes` ([list] of strings) `attributes` : alias for `attr.attributes` ([Attributes]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Header` (string) ### HorizontalRule A horizontal rule. `tag`, `t` : the literal `HorizontalRule` (string) ### LineBlock A line block, i.e. a list of lines, each separated from the next by a newline. `content` : inline content `tag`, `t` : the literal `LineBlock` (string) ### Null A null element; this element never produces any output in the target format. `tag`, `t` : the literal `Null` (string) ### OrderedList An ordered list. Parameters: `items` : list items ([list] of [blocks]) `listAttributes` : list parameters (ListAttributes) `start` : alias for `listAttributes.start` (integer) `style` : alias for `listAttributes.style` (string) `delimiter` : alias for `listAttributes.delimiter` (string) `tag`, `t` : the literal `OrderedList` (string) ### Para A paragraph `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Para` (string) ### Plain Plain text, not a paragraph `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Plain` (string) ### RawBlock Raw content of a specified format. `format` : format of content (string) `text` : raw content (string) `tag`, `t` : the literal `RawBlock` (string) ### Table A table. `caption` : table caption ([list] of [inlines]) `aligns` : column alignments ([list] of [Alignment]s) `widths` : column widths (number) `headers` : header row ([list] of [table cells](#table-cell)) `rows` : table rows ([list] of [list]s of [table cells](#table-cell))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Table` (string) A [table cell]{#table-cell} is a list of blocks. [Alignment]{#Alignment} is a string value indicating the horizontal alignment of a table column. `AlignLeft`, `AlignRight`, and `AlignCenter` leads cell content tob be left-aligned, right-aligned, and centered, respectively. The default alignment is `AlignDefault` (often equivalent to centered). ## Inline ### Cite Citation `content` : ([list] of [inlines]) `citations` : citation entries ([list] of [citations]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Cite` (string) ### Code Inline code `text` : code string (string) `attr` : attributes ([Attr]) `identifier` : alias for `attr.identifier` (string) `classes` : alias for `attr.classes` ([list] of strings) `attributes` : alias for `attr.attributes` ([Attributes]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Code` (string) ### Emph Emphasized text `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Emph` (string) ### Image Image: alt text (list of inlines), target `attr` : attributes ([Attr]) `caption` : text used to describe the image ([list] of [inlines]) `src` : path to the image file (string) `title` : brief image description `identifier` : alias for `attr.identifier` (string) `classes` : alias for `attr.classes` ([list] of strings) `attributes` : alias for `attr.attributes` ([Attributes]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Image` (string) ### LineBreak Hard line break `tag`, `t` : the literal `LineBreak` (string) ### Link Hyperlink: alt text (list of inlines), target `attr` : attributes ([Attr]) `content` : text for this link ([list] of [inlines]) `target` : the link target (string) `identifier` : alias for `attr.identifier` (string) `classes` : alias for `attr.classes` ([list] of strings) `attributes` : alias for `attr.attributes` ([Attributes]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Link` (string) ### Math TeX math (literal) `mathype` : specifier determining whether the math content should be shown inline (`InlineMath`) or on a separate line (`DisplayMath`) (string) `text` : math content (string)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Math` (string) ### Note Footnote or endnote `content` : ([list] of [blocks]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Note` (string) ### Quoted Quoted text `quotetype` : type of quotes to be used; one of `SingleQuote` or `DoubleQuote` (string) `content` : quoted text 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Quoted` (string) ### RawInline Raw inline `format` : the format of the content (string) `text` : raw content (string) `tag`, `t` : the literal `RawInline` (string) ### SmallCaps Small caps text `content` : 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`SmallCaps` (string) ### SoftBreak Soft line break `tag`, `t` : the literal `SoftBreak` (string) ### Space Inter-word space `tag`, `t` : the literal `Space` (string) ### Span Generic inline container with attributes `attr` : attributes ([Attr]) `content` : wrapped content ([list] of [inlines]) `identifier` : alias for `attr.identifier` (string) `classes` : alias for `attr.classes` ([list] of strings) `attributes` : alias for `attr.attributes` ([Attributes]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Span` (string) ### Str Text `text` : content (string)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Str` (string) ### Strikeout Strikeout text `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Strikeout` (string) ### Strong Strongly emphasized text `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Strong` (string) ### Subscript Subscripted text `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Subscript` (string) ### Superscript Superscripted text `content` : inline content ([list] of [inlines]) `tag`, `t` : the literal `Superscript` (string) ## Element components ### Attr A set of element attributes `identifier` : element identifier (string) `classes` : element classes ([list] of strings) `attributes` : collection of key/value pairs ([Attributes]) ### Attributes List of key/value pairs. Values can be accessed by using keys as indices to the list table. ### Citation Single citation entry `id` : citation identifier, e.g., a bibtex key (string) `mode` : citation mode, one of `AuthorInText`, `SuppressAuthor`, or `NormalCitation` (string) `prefix` : citation prefix ([list] of [inlines]) `suffix` : citation suffix ([list] of [inlines]) `note_num` : note number (integer) `hash` : hash (integer) ### ListAttributes List attributes `start` : number of the first list item (integer) `style` : style used for list numbers; possible values are `DefaultStyle`, `Example`, `Decimal`, `LowerRoman`, `UpperRoman`, `LowerAlpha`, and `UpperAlpha` (string) `delimiter` : delimiter of list numbers; one of `DefaultDelim`, `Period`, `OneParen`, and `TwoParens` (string) ## Hierarchical Element {#Element} Hierarchical elements can be either *Sec* (sections) or *Blk* (blocks). *Blk* elements are treated like [block]s. ### Sec Section elements used to provide hierarchical information on document contents. **Objects of this type are read-only.** `level` : header level (integer) `numbering` : section numbering ([list] of integers) `attr` : header attributes ([Attr]) `label` : header content ([list] of [inlines]) `contents` : list of contents in this section ([list] of hierarchical elements) `tag`, `t` : constant `Sec` (string) ## ReaderOptions Pandoc reader options `abbreviations` : set of known abbreviations (set of strings) `columns` : number of columns in terminal (integer) `default_image_extension` : default extension for images (string) `extensions` : string representation of the syntax extensions bit field (string) `indented_code_classes` : default classes for indented code blocks (list of strings) `standalone` : whether the input was a standalone document with header (boolean) `strip_comments` : HTML comments are stripped instead of parsed as raw HTML (boolean) `tab_stop` : width (i.e. equivalent number of spaces) of tab stops (integer) `track_changes` : track changes setting for docx; one of `AcceptChanges`, `RejectChanges`, and `AllChanges` (string) [block]: #block [blocks]: #block [list]: #list [meta value]: #metavalue [inline]: #inline [inlines]: #inline [Attr]: #attr [Attributes]: #attributes [citations]: #citation
